Notes
--> There was no play on the final day.
--> JE Walsh made his last appearance in County Championship matches
--> JE Walsh made his last appearance in First-Class matches
--> MR Hallam (1) passed his previous highest score of 98 in First-Class matches
--> MR Hallam (1) made his first century in First-Class matches
--> MR Hallam (1) passed his previous highest score of 98 in County Championship matches
--> MR Hallam (1) made his first century in County Championship matches
--> MR Hallam (1) passed 4000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 95
--> M Tompkin (1) passed 19500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 15
--> AC Shirreff achieved his best innings bowling analysis in First-Class matches in the Leicestershire first innings (previous best was 7-81)
--> AC Shirreff achieved his best innings bowling analysis in County Championship matches in the Leicestershire first innings (previous best was 6-55)
